These mapped faults are modified from Plate 2, Principal structural features, Gulf of Mexico Basin (compiled by T.E. Ewing and R.F. Lopez) in Volume J, The Geology of North America (1991); Plate 2, Geologic map of the U.S. Appalachians showing the Laurentian margin and the Taconic orogen (compiled by D.R. Rankin, A.A. Drake, and N.M. Ratcliffe) in Volume F-2, The Geology of North America (1989); and Plate 9, Tectonic map of the Ouachita orogen (compiled by W.A. Thomas) in Volume F-2, The Geology of North America (1989).
This dataset contains basic data and interpretations developed and compiled by the U.S. Geological Survey's Framework Studies and Assessment of the Gulf Coast Project. Other major sources of data include publicly available information from state agencies as well as publications of the U.S. Geological Survey and other scientific organizations. In cases where company proprietary data were used to produce various derivatives such as contour surfaces, the source is cited but the data are not displayed.
The dataset was developed primarily to facilitate the synthesis and analysis of various data types required in the assessment of energy resources and to aid in the study and visualization of framework elements and processes. In addition the dataset provides access to the information in an easily usable format for those outside of the USGS.

The accuracy of the faults, as generated using ArcGIS depends upon the accuracy of the paper maps provided by the Geological Society of America. The assumption was made that the paper maps are of sufficient accuracy for the Gulf Coast Project.
It is assumed that the paper maps from the Geological Society of America are complete and therefore the line work created from the paper maps is complete.

The paper maps were scanned and made into tiff images. The tiff images were imported into ArcGIS and registered to a counties shapefile. The line work on the images for the faults was digitized and saved as a shapefile.
